Myself and a party of 13 stopped at this hotel for two nights in August 2025. It is in a great location, but opposite the hotel is another single story building being built, which may or may not belong to the hotel itself, but the location of the new building blocks the beautiful view over the valley, at least for guests stopping in rooms on the first two floors. The draw for all of us to book this hotel was the roof top pool, which offers stunning views. The only criticism of the roof top pool is the lack of anywhere to sit or lay out in the sun. There is two sun loungers & one setter type item without any padding/cushions. There is also nowhere to hang towels etc. Towels are supplied by the hotel, along with lockers for valuables while you are at the pool. The other issue with the pool is the immediate area outside the lift. People come from the pool & don't dry off properly, so there is layer of water on the steps down to the lift area & a member of our party fell down the stairs as it is so very slippery. Breakfast was included & while I accept the hotel cannot cater for all tastes, I wish there had been more fresh fruit other than just water melon. The location is great, but if you want to walk into the town area, one option is to climb a large number of steps on a very steep incline. You could argue that due to the inexpensive option of getting a Grab Taxi to the town, that might be the better option, but the stairs are a challenge - going up and coming down. Reception staff were pleasant and helpful. We hired a motorbike for an afternoon to see more of the local area.
